Abstract
The design of a charge breeder consisting of a surface ion source coupled to a dual frequency 14 and 10 GHz Electron Cyclotron Resonance ion-source (ECRIS) is presented. The simulations show that the decelerated 1+ beam could be focused to a spot size smaller than the radial dimensions of the plasma using a gradual deceleration scheme. A high capture and 1+⇒n+ conversion efficiency could be possible for radioactive ions using this design.
